Output 01c6313cbb3513b92bf0c4e639c9701eabd9a80048cf9d661ec9c3412c5331a8:3

value
161112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eeef6c4246e7bfeee6666869e7134f0592ba9fdb OP_EQUAL
address
3PUPZbMggxuHjeQuWT9qxqeCVFkbkKceFh
transaction
01c6313cbb3513b92bf0c4e639c9701eabd9a80048cf9d661ec9c3412c5331a8
confirmations
150615
spent
true